Determine the stress in the meridional direction:

A doubly curved shell of thickness 8 mm is filled through a liquid under an internal pressure of 2.0 N/mm2. At a specific point on the shell having radii of curvature 800 mm and 500 mm, the stress along with the circumferential direction is found to be 40 N/mm2. Determine the stress in the meridional direction.

Solution

Thickness, t = 8 mm.

Internal pressure, p = 2 N/mm2.

Circumferential stress, f1 = 40 N/mm2.

Radius, r1 = 800 mm.

Meridional radius, r2 = 500 mm.

Using the relationship,

f1  / r1 +  f2 / r2 =  p/ t             

40/ 800   +   f2 /500  = 2/8

f2   = ((2 /8 )- (40 /800)) × 500 = 100 N/mm2
